The chase for the NCAA Division II championship continues for the CSU Dominguez men’s and women’s basketball teams.
In Pittsburgh, the women kicked off their Elite Eight action Monday with an 82-66 win over Coker. Teagan Thurman led the Toros with 23 points, Cristina Jones had 20 and 10 rebounds and Nala Williams scored 19 and grabbed eight rebounds.
The Toros will face seventh-seeded Union (Tennessee) in Wednesday’s semifinal at 3 p.m. The other semifinal will feature fourth-seed Pittsburgh St. against top-seed Grand Valley St. The winners of the semifinals will meet Friday in the national championship.
In Indiana, the CSUDH men defeated West Liberty 86-84 Tuesday. David Cheatom led the way with 22 points, Jeremy Dent-Smith had 19 and seven rebounds. Adam Afifi had 12 points, DJ Guest scored 11 points and Jordan Hilstock had 10. Alex Garcia scored eight points and grabbed nine rebounds.
The Toros trailed 60-48 with 16:15 remaining. Garcia scored with 24 seconds remaining to give the Toros an 86-82 lead.
The Toros will face third-seed Dallas Baptist in Thursday’s semifinal.
